Protecting Children from Violence : Evidence-Based Interventions.

Providing an evidence based understanding of the causes and consequences of violence against children, this title examines the best practices used to help protect children from violence. It reviews various types of violence, including physical and sexual abuse, (cyber- )bullying, human trafficking,...
